Recruitment to the role of Service Director for Children, Young People and Families Additional documents: Minutes: Chris Squire (Service Director for HROD) presented the report and made the following key points:
a) A recruitment process to the role of permanent Service Director for Children, Young People and Families had commenced to replace the current interim who had been brought in to cover the previous permanent role holder due to a period of illness;
b) The previous permanent postholder resigned the position to continue their recovery;
c) There were a number of candidates that declared an interest in the role and following technical interviews, two candidates were taken through to the assessment centre which involved interview panels by Cabinet members, the Executive, Senior Leadership Team and children and young people. The assessment centre also involved financial and psychological assessments;
d) Following the assessment centre process, one candidate was selected for interview by this Panel.
The Panel agreed to:
1. Note the content of the report;
2. Accept the recommendation that one candidate had progressed to interview by this Panel;
3. Undertake a formal interview on 16 January 2026. |

Recruitment to the role of Service Director for Children, Young People and Families Additional documents:
Minutes: Following an interview process, the Panel agreed to appoint Emmy Tomsett as Service Director for Children, Young People and Families subject to Cabinet approval and the necessary pre-employment checks. |

Extension to contract for Interim Service Director Street Scene & Waste Minutes: (Please note that there is a confidential minute to this item)
The Panel agreed to re-order the agenda to hear this item before minute 45.
The Panel agreed to:
1. Extend the contract of Andy Sharp in the role of interim Service Director for Street Services under the current terms and conditions for a further six months whilst the permanent recruitment process took place.
For: (6) Councillors Laing, Aspinall, Briars-Delve, Blight, Mrs Beer and Lugger.
Against: (0)
Abstain: (1) Councillor Coker. |
